One of the significant advantages of Cal Hypo Granular is its high concentration of available chlorine, which typically ranges between 65% to 70%. This concentration allows for fewer quantities to be used compared to other chlorine products, leading to lower transportation and storage costs. Furthermore, Cal Hypo Granular is relatively stable when stored under the right conditions, making it suitable for long-term use.
Cal Hypo Granular is typically added to water in a powdered form, requiring careful handling to prevent dust inhalation and skin contact. When using this chemical, it is critical to follow proper safety protocols, including wearing personal protective equipment (PPE) such as gloves, goggles, and masks. Additionally, it should be stored in a cool, dry place away from incompatible substances like acids and organic materials to avoid hazardous reactions.
In terms of application, the dosage of Cal Hypo Granular depends on several factors, including the volume of water being treated, the level of contamination, and the desired residual chlorine concentration. Regular monitoring of chlorine levels is essential to ensure effective disinfection while preventing over-chlorination, which can lead to health risks and unpleasant by-products.
Beyond water treatment, Cal Hypo Granular finds applications in other sectors such as agriculture, where it is used as a bleaching agent in the production of cellulose and as a disinfectant for equipment and facilities. Its versatility also extends to the textile industry, where it is employed for dyeing and bleaching processes.
